Breaston is an award winning village which now benefits from the Breaston in Bloom village initiative, there is an excellent local school for younger children with schools for older children being found in Long Eaton where there are the Wilsthopre and Trent College schools which are only a few minutes drive away, as well as local shops found in the village there are Asda and Tesco superstores and many other retail outlets found in Long Eaton town centre, there are several local golf courses, walks in the surrounding picturesque countryside and the excellent transport links include J25 of the M1, East Midlands Airport, stations at Long Eaton and East Midlands Parkway and the A52 and other main roads, all of which provide good links to Nottingham, Derby and other East Midlands towns and cities.
